My solution to the posting pic issue is to email the pictures to myself. I use outlook in windows xp. Anytime I email pics, it asks if I want to make them smaller to email easier. i click ok and it automatically reduces the size. I get my own email and save the pics to a folder. Voila!! instant small pics. It does not affect the original and makes automatic smaller copies to post or email.
I guess this would only work in outlook though. Good Luck!!

i'm trying to put my refuge. together but i just had a q. i bought the refuge. mud and woundering if i can just put the mud in?, and if is not going to get the nitrate high?

dj9264
03-12-2007, 09:22 AM
Turn the water flow to the fuge off untill the mud settles and over time it will help to lower nitrate.
